From f40dcc7e2054a99977d444c5fa36868fba2c3f36 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ingo Schwarze Date: Sun, 23 Mar 2014 11:25:25 +0000 Subject: The files mandoc.c and mandoc.h contained both specialised low-level functions used for multiple languages (mdoc, man, roff), for example mandoc_escape(), mandoc_getarg(), mandoc_eos(), and generic auxiliary functions. Split the auxiliaries out into their own file and header.
